To thrive at the Ethereum Foundation, professionals need deep expertise in blockchain technology, cryptography, and decentralized application development, often backed by a strong academic or industry background. Familiarity with programming languages such as Solidity, experience with distributed ledger platforms, and relevant certifications in blockchain or security are highly valuable. Curiosity, effective communication, and collaborative problem-solving are stand-out soft skills for this globally distributed, innovative environment. These attributes are crucial for advancing the Ethereum ecosystem and driving impactful, open-source initiatives in a rapidly evolving field.
